City Works To Eradicate Brown Spaces

The importance of urban green spaces has been recognized by Canadian urban planners for years–but what about brown spaces?

Saint John Common Shirley McAlary is speaking up in support of a new policy that would eradicate a blight on urban centres–.the so-called brown spaces, otherwise known as vacant lots that aren’t being used for parking or anything else.

The suggestion is that if a building is torn down or fire damaged, the property owner should have a responsibilty to grass over the lot within a certain timeframe–a law that’s already in place in several municipalities.
